Methanol

A small alcohol released not by fermentation but by enzymes stripping methyl groups off pectin, which is why juice handling rather than yeast choice governs how much a cider contains.

Also called Methyl alcohol.

Measured figures

Shown as they were measured, with the context each was taken in. They are not averaged: a concentration recorded in one country's fruit in one decade is not a constant.

Methanol40.0–87.0 mg/L

Villaviciosa, Asturias, Spain, 2001–2002 · 4 samples · Gas chromatography with flame ionisation detection · Suárez Valles, Pando Bedriñana, Fernández Tascón, Querol Simón and Rodríguez Madrera, Food Microbiology 24(1):25–31

Traced by the authors to the raw material rather than to the ferment — methanol comes off the pectin in the fruit, not out of the yeast. The harvest changed the figure by a factor of two while the pressing technology barely moved it.

Released when pectin is de-esterified, so it tracks the fruit and the enzyme rather than anything the yeast did. Measured in milligrams per litre.

About Methanol

Pectin is a chain of galacturonic acid units, many of them capped with a methyl ester group. Remove that cap — which is exactly what pectin methylesterase does, whether the enzyme comes from the fruit itself or from a commercial preparation added to the juice — and the methyl group leaves as methanol. Every cider therefore contains some, in the tens to low hundreds of milligrams per litre, and a cider made from long-macerated pomace or from enzyme-treated juice contains more than one pressed quickly from fresh fruit.

The practical consequence for cider is small, because methanol at those concentrations is neither tasted nor smelled and is present in comparable amounts in ordinary fruit juice. The consequence for distillation is not small. Distilling concentrates the volatile fraction, and methanol runs early, which is why apple spirit production is regulated with methanol limits and why the heads cut in a Calvados still is a technical requirement rather than a stylistic one.

The interesting inversion is that the practices which produce the most methanol are also the ones a cidermaker may most want. Keeving depends on pectin methylesterase acting on juice pectin — the whole process is built on de-esterification — and long maceration before pressing improves both yield and phenolic extraction. In cider these are choices with no drinking consequence; in a still they are choices that have to be managed downstream.
